Further Information

Bioactivity:
Upadacitinib (ABT-494) is a selective Janus kinase (JAK) 1 inhibitor, which is being studied for the treatment of several autoimmune disorders in the IC50 of 43 nM.
CAS:
1310726-60-3
Formula:
C17H19F3N6O
Molecular Weight:
380.375
Pathway:
JAK/STAT signaling; Stem Cells; Chromatin/Epigenetic; Angiogenesis
Purity:
0.9989
SMILES:
CC[C@@H]1CN(C[C@@H]1c1cnc2cnc3[nH]ccc3n12)C(=O)NCC(F)(F)F
Target:
JAK
